If you also likes to surf spend a few days at the Northwest coast of the island.
In February you have a lot of "cool front" on the area and they can generate big swells
Shacks in Isabela is a good spot on the northwest for kitesurf. "Montones" is also another spot
near shacks.....................
La parguera is a good flat water spot on the Southwest.
